Melania Trump statue sawed off at ankles and stolen from Slovenian hometown

A bronze statue of Melania Trump was recently stolen in her native Slovenia, marking the second time a statue of the first lady has been targeted. The original wooden statue, placed near her hometown of Sevnica in 2020, was replaced by the bronze statue after being damaged in an arson attack following the end of President Donald Trump’s first term.

Both statues were a collaboration between artist Brad Downey from Kentucky and local craftsman Ales “Maxi” Zupevc. The original wooden statue depicted Melania Trump in a pale blue dress, reminiscent of the outfit she wore at her husband’s 2016 inauguration.

The new bronze statue was created to be more durable and was placed on the same stump as the original. However, it was recently sawed off at the ankles and stolen. Slovenian police are currently investigating the theft and vandalism.

Franja Kranjc, a worker at a local bakery, expressed that the rustic statue was not well-liked and that its removal is acceptable. Zupevc, who carved the original statue with a chainsaw, shared that he was inspired to create the design as both he and Melania Trump were born in the same hospital.

A plaque next to the statue reads, “dedicated to the eternal memory of a monument to Melania which stood at this location.” Melania Trump, born Melanija Knavs in Novo Mesto in 1970, grew up in Sevnica during Slovenia’s time as part of Communist-ruled Yugoslavia. Slovenia is now a member of the European Union and NATO.
